### Changelog — Corvid UI library, versioning defaults

v9.0 changes default version resolution for plugins. Caret ranges now pin to the library's LTS line instead of latest. Prerelease tags are ignored unless explicitly opted in. Update your manifests before the Thistledown registry enforces this. The resolver ships with the following defaults.

deployment values, yadug-bawif:
[framir]
team = pelox
access_code = ac_a38ab2
owner = tamion.julael
host = framir.tolvaqlabs.test
port = 11211
peer = tammir.zemvargrid.local
salt = 2215ef03
pin = 1541

Document Transport — Replacement Server for Kestrel Row Branch. Dispatch desk procedure: the replacement server unit from Ardaneth Systems ships in a padded transit case with two tamper seals. Verify both seal numbers against the transfer form before release, and record the case weight. The unit must remain upright and may not be left unattended at any point. At the branch, the courier follows this confidential instruction:

dispatch memo: the lamwyn fenwyn courier leaves the wenir ledger at gate 7175 under passcode 822969

Q: There's a group of interns arriving this week — does that change contractor access at Dunmore Wharf? A: Yes, slightly. The intern cohort starts Tuesday and will occupy the second-floor open area, so contractors should use the rear goods entrance rather than the main lobby between 08:30 and 10:00 to avoid the induction queue. Sign-in remains at the security desk as usual. The rear entrance keypad accepts the contractor access code below.

badge for fafop-fajof: bdg-Z-47

Each validator plugin runs in an isolated worker with bounded memory and CPU shares; untrusted plugins cannot exceed their slice even under adversarial input. We size the pool for peak ingest on the Corvane pipeline plus 40% headroom, and plugins that exceed their wall-clock budget are killed and quarantined. These bounds are enforced in the supervisor, not the plugin, so they hold regardless of plugin behavior. The enforced limits are defined by the following constants.

tuning constants:
QUOTAS = {
    "julwyn": 448,
    "belix": 11,
}